75cl bottle @ SuperBest, Odense. Pours slight unclear copper/orange with a small white head. Nose is sweet of bread, caramel and fruits. Some hay, grassy and floral flavors. Medium bodied. Medium to low carbonation. Quite sweet. Bread and orange fruit dominates. Drinkable.

Bottled. A dark golden beer with a huge orangey head, is it over carbonation or a slight infection? The aroma is sweet, but with a slight acidic edge and notes of malt, caramel, bread, and dusty hops. The flavor is sweet malty with notes of caramel and bread, but also lighter notes of dusty hops, alcohol, and eggs, leading to a medium bitter finish.

Bottle 75cl. @ chris_o’s Pre-GBBF Shindig 2008.Clear medium yellow amber color with a average, frothy, good lacing, mostly lasting, off-white head. Aroma is moderate malty, toasted, grain, fruity - sour malt notes ala apples. Flavor is moderate sweet with a average to long duration. Body is medium to light, texture is oily to watery, carbonation is soft. (020808)
